The concept of a Dashboard appears nearly everywhere. Most obvious are car dashboards with displays of speed, mileage, and navigation. Less obvious examples are: the FaceBook banner with notifications, informational displays in lobbies, and “widgets” on iOS and Android. A portion of a larger display is a widget.

Why Does This Exist?

  • APIs allows for alternative User Interfaces for same information

  • Real products and real data, versus static prototypes

  • Dashboards convey information in real-time — without prompting

  • Apply concepts from Web Design 1 and 2 with APIs from Web 3

Although dashboards are potentially powerful, this potential is rarely realized. The greatest display technology in the world won't solve this if you fail to use effective visual design - Stephen Few, Author of Information Dashboard Design: The Effective Visual Communication of Data
